DISPLAY MODE

The red LED (see ref. 5 on page 18) comes on in the event of faults that cause the permanent lockout of a heating unit
(normal operation is reset only by pressing the Master or Slave reset button).
The 3 digits with seven segments display the status of the system:
Status of the system
No central heating or DHW demand.
The two digits on the right display the outlet temperature T1. E.g.: T1 = 30°C
Demand from circuit no.1 or from circuits 1 and 2 together.
The two digits on the right display the outlet temp. T1. E.g.: T1 = 80°C
Demand from the DHW circuit or simultaneous operation.
The two digits on the right display the outlet temp. T1 E.g.: T1 = 80°C.
The decimal point after the 1st digit on the left flashes
Demand from the 2nd circuit
The two digits on the right display the outlet temperature T1. E.g. T1 = 80°C.
Anti-frost function

READOUT MODE

(TEMPERATURE VALUES AND OPERATING STATUS OF THE VARIOUS CIRCUITS)
20
Press the "[" button to scroll forwards and display the values set for the individual circuits.
The values listed below will be displayed in sequence when pressing the "[" button.
Value displayed
1
Outlet temperature T1 in the high temperature circuit. E.g. : T1 = 80°C
2
DHW temperature T3. E.g.: storage heater temperature = 50°C
3
Outside temperature T4. E.g. T4 = 7°C
4
Outlet temperature in 2nd circuit or low temperature circuit T6
5
Room thermostat in the 1st circuit, closed or open.
OFF = contact open
ON = contact closed
6
Room thermostat in the 2nd circuit, closed or open
OFF = contact open
ON = contact closed
7
0-10V analogue input
E.g. 5.5V, 10V
